Chilean vs American Child Poverty Under the Age of 5 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 249,794,467 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Chileans and poverty level among children under the age of 5 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.011 and weighted average of 15.6%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 538,793,741 people shows a significant positive correlation between the proportion of Americans and poverty level among children under the age of 5 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.682 and weighted average of 20.5%, a difference of 31.4%.
